Lets compare vitamin content per 100 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ds vs Cinnamon Bread:
100 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have 12.5 times more Vitamin B6, 1.8 times more Vitamin B9 and 31.1 times more Vitamin E than Cinnamon Bread.
While 100 kcal of Cinnamon Bread contain 2.3 times more Vitamin B1, 1.6 times more Vitamin B3 and 7.2 times more Vitamin K than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els.
Both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ds and Cinnamon Bread provide similar amounts of Vitamin B2 per 100 calories.
100 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have insufficient amounts of Vitamin K
100 calories of Cinnamon Bread have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B6 and Vitamin E
Both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els as well as Cinnamon Bread have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12, Vitamin C and Vitamin D in 100 calories.
Comparing minerals per 100 calories for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ds vs Cinnamon Bread:
100 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have 12 times more Copper, 4.9 times more Magnesium, 8.5 times more Phosphorus, 2.8 times more Potassium, 2.7 times more Selenium and 4.5 times more Zinc than Cinnamon Bread.
While 100 kcal of Cinnamon Bread contain 1.9 times more Calcium, 1.4 times more Iron and 302.6 times more Sodium than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els.
100 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
100 calories of Cinnamon Bread lack sufficient amounts of Magnesium, Potassium and Zinc
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 calories:
100 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have 4.1 times more Fat, more Saturated Fat, 4.7 times more Omega 6, 1.3 times more Fiber and 1.2 times more Protein than Cinnamon Bread.
While 100 kcal of Cinnamon Bread contain 11.7 times more Omega 3, 4.5 times more Carbohydrate and 10.6 times more Sugars than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els.
Both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ds and Cinnamon Bread offer comparable quantities of Energy per 100 calories.
100 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3
